I tried almost all desktop environment on Linux. I used too many Linux distributions to try those desktop-environments on. I used Ubuntu, Manjaro, Clear Linux OS, Elementary OS and Linux Mint. The Desktop Environments I tried are GNOME 3, KDE Plasma 3, XFCE, Budgie, Pantheon, Cinnamon, LXDE and MATE.
It is worth mentioning that the laptop I tried those on is a modern laptop with intel core i7 processor, 16GB of RAM, 500GB SSD storage and Intel GPU with AMD one.
My honest opinion, I loved Gnome 3 and Pantheon desktop environments more than any other desktop environment. I loved GNOME 3 more than Pantheon, if you wonder.
Why I like GNOME 3 and Pantheon more than others ?
- Both are ready to be used out-of-the-box. other desktop environment are not good enough to work with from the first interaction.
- Both GNOME 3 and Pantheon have a theme or pattern of design which help you as a user to blend it -- if you have the same interest for design elegance, simplicity and minimalism.
- Both are minimal with feature-rich ability when you need it.
- Guess what? GNOME 3 and Pantheon are more performant on my laptop! That's shocking to me! KDE Plasma 3 is horrible on my laptop - which shocked me too. Which is more performant, GNOME or Pantheon ? guess which?? it is GNOME !
